InterSystems - About the company
InterSystems is an acquired company based in Cambridge (United States), founded in 1978 by . It operates as a Cloud based database management software. The company has 1193 active competitors, including 143 funded and 80 that have exited. Its top competitors include companies like Informatica, EDB and Nexla.
Company Details
Cloud based database management software. It enables users to store and manage the data to streamline the analysis process and support the decision making process. The platform provides multi modal database engine to store and process the data. Features includes embedded analytics, sql access, and more. It caters to industries such as logistics, mining, healthcare, and more.
